U.S. Cellular, established in 1983 and headquartered in the United States, operates within the telecommunications industry, providing a range of services across various sectors including wireless communications and diversified communication services. With approximately 4,100 employees and reported revenues of $3.77 billion, the company focuses on delivering telecommunications solutions to both individual and business customers. One of the notable offerings highlighted in their published document is Unified Communications as a Service (UCaaS), which was implemented by the City of Carthage, Missouri, to enhance communication among its municipal buildings. This solution included features such as VoIP services, call routing, and electronic faxing, aimed at streamlining operations and reducing costs associated with outdated legacy systems.
